2006 New York Code - Acquisition Of Real Property; Financing Of Expenditures
§ 396-j. Acquisition of real property; financing of expenditures. Real property required for any of the purposes set forth in this article shall be acquired by the county legislative body on behalf of the authority. Nothing contained in this article, shall be construed to prevent the financing, in whole or in part, pursuant to the local finance law of any expenditure made to carry out the purposes of this article.
